The Trust Economy
Here's a hard truth most fitness professionals don't want to acknowledge: your certifications, your personal physique, and even your years of experience matter less to potential clients than what your current clients say about you.

We're living in a trust economy where:
93% of consumers read online reviews before choosing a local business
87% of fitness clients report checking reviews before contacting a trainer
84% trust online reviews as much as personal recommendations
49% require at least a 4-star rating to consider a fitness service
When a potential client searches "personal trainer near me," Google's algorithm heavily favors businesses with more reviews and higher ratings. Without those reviews, you're essentially invisible—no matter how transformative your training might be.
Even more brutal? The absence of recent reviews sends a powerful negative signal. A profile with only three old reviews suggests either:
You haven't had any satisfied clients recently, or
Your current clients aren't impressed enough to leave reviews
Neither interpretation helps your business.

The Timing Problem
Even when trainers overcome their reluctance and ask for reviews, they often do it at exactly the wrong moment:
Asking too early: "I know this is only your third session, but would you mind leaving us a review?"
Asking at random: "Oh by the way, before you leave—would you mind leaving a review when you get a chance?"
Asking too late: "I know we finished working together three months ago, but I'm trying to build up my reviews..."
The psychology of review completion is actually quite predictable:
Clients are most likely to complete reviews when they've just experienced a win or milestone
The likelihood of completion drops by 80% after 24 hours
The quality of reviews (detail, enthusiasm) decreases significantly when not tied to a specific achievement
In other words, there is a perfect moment to request a review from every client—and most trainers miss it completely.

The Automation Advantage
The most successful fitness businesses have discovered a simple truth: systematic approaches to review generation outperform manual requests every time.
Here's why automation works better:
Perfect timing: Automated systems can trigger review requests at predetermined milestones (8 sessions completed, 15 pounds lost, first pull-up achieved)
No awkwardness: The system handles the ask, removing the psychological barrier
Consistent follow-up: Gentle reminders increase completion rates without requiring uncomfortable persistence from the trainer
Sentiment filtering: Smart systems can first check if the client is satisfied before requesting the public review
Review routing: Positive experiences get directed to Google Business; concerns get routed privately to you for resolution
The trainers and gyms implementing these systems report 400-800% increases in review generation within the first 90 days—without changing anything about their actual service quality.
The Implementation Reality
The good news is that systematizing your review collection doesn't require complex technology or major business overhauls:
Identify trigger points: Determine the natural moments of client satisfaction in your program (session milestones, achievement markers, physical changes)
Create a simple ask: Develop a template message that feels personal but is easy to deploy consistently
Build in follow-up: Plan for 1-2 gentle reminders that respect the client's time while increasing completion rates
Connect to referrals: Use completed reviews as natural openings to discuss referrals
For many trainers, the simple act of systematizing review requests results in a 10-30% business growth within six months—with zero additional marketing spend.
